You will now be directed to the Pixlr Desktop. It will look like this:



1. Your editing tools are on the left side
2. Your "canvas" is in the middle. This is where you will be creating your logo
3. Your layers are on your right. Where all of your editing gets placed, where you can reference each edit, delete changes you've made etc.
4. Your toolbar is on top. File, Edit, Image, etc.

To Create Your Logo from an existing Picture
1. Go to your toolbar, go to File, Choose Open Image
2. Choose your image from your computer file.
3. Another image box will open up on top of your canvas. (see below)





Your picture will need to be resized to be used in the header.
1. Click on "Image" on your toolbar
2. Click on "Image Size"
3. Resize the height of the picture (as we are specifically working on a header in this case), be sure that "constrain proportions" is checked





Your image will now be small enough to add to your canvas.
1. Click on "Edit", "select all"
2. Click on "Copy"

Switch to your Canvas - click on your canvas
1. Click on "edit", "Paste"

Your Picture should now be in the center of your canvas.




You can now exit out of the imported image. No need to save changes.
Keep your Canvas open - Titled "Our Custom Logo"

To move your logo to the left, we will use the "move" tool:


Click on the "Move" tool, then go back to your image and drag it to the position you want it to reside.
